The Third line of The Metropolitan Expressway(Part 2)

1.Field of application

The third line of the metropolitan expressway, Tokyo.

2.Circumstances of Repair

Fatigue cracks were found in the welded joints which joined the gusset plates of lateral bracings to the web panels of the main girders in 2000 after 28 years of service.

3.Types of structure

The outline of the bridge structure is as follows.

4.Details of loading

Fluctuating loads due to expressway live load.

5.Description of damage

The one of the fatigue cracks is shown in Fig.1.Fig.2 shows classification of the crack position that occurred in the weld of gusset.These cracks were found from 2000 to 2004.The result in Fig.2 indicates that the most cracks is tpye2.

As a result of stress measurement and FEM analysis , the causes of the type1 and type2 to show as follows were estimated.The cause of type1 was the stress concentration in the edge of the gusset which occurred by local bending of the web plates of the main girder.The cause of type2 was the local deformation in the vicinity of the scallop which occurred by axial force of the lateral bracing.
